Welcome to MakeupFix.net



I am Mrs. Lynne and I am the online personality behind MakeupFix.net. It brings me great pleasure to unveil to you a place I call my second home. A place where I hope you'll find "a motherly dose of anything makeup, anything beauty"!

The site was revamped with one thing in mind: to make the information on here, as well as upcoming, easier to navigate through so that existing and new MakeupFixers can find what they need with some sort of ease.

This blog started off as a personal makeup growth journal in which I could reference my progression as I tried new makeup techniques/looks and posted my journey. Since the doors opened in November 2007, the blog has escalated in exposure and the people responsible for the survival of this place are none other than the loyal MakeupFixers, who are a remarkable bunch to say the least and I cannot thank
each of you enough!

So, you know that I love makeup and that I run this shop, but what else lies behind the identity of Mrs. Lynne?

For starters, I'm happily married to my Prince Charming, a mother of two magnificent children, and a person in shock (or denial) to the fact that I have officially entered my late 20's. MAC is currently my favorite cosmetics retailer and I'm an NC42 for reference. I'm the youngest of three girls, born and raised in the Silicon Valley of California, and now reside in the lovely paradise known as Hawai'i. I'm a perfectionist at heart and a slightly OCD one at that. I have a sugar tooth for Haribo Gummy Bears even in the early hours of the morning.
I'm a huge advocate for personal growth and love self-help books. I like to laugh, comically make fun of people I know, and I try to incorporate humor into everything I do (voted 2nd place as Class Clown in highschool) because I believe the harder you laugh, the longer you live, and the more fun you have.

Makeup and color has always been a passion of mine since childhood. Some of my professional experience and knowledge derives from the days when I used to be a Distributor for an all-day makeup company as well as my ongoing passion as an aspiring Freelance Makeup Artist. Through these milestones I've acquired experience in product training while some of my work has been summoned for special events.
I never worked a cosmetics counter or went to makeup artistry school, but would one day hope to fulfill a long awaited dream of mine to go to Cosmetology school and perhaps concentrate on Esthetics as well. But in the meantime, I live and breathe this blog and will continue to tinker and research as I pursue to grow and mold my cosmetics-hungry-brain.
